DianneFlew with Turkish AirlinesIST-SINAug 2024
Be aware that Istanbul requires a visa for Australians at 50 eur per person for entry up to 90 days. We only spent 6 hours on a Touristanbool tour organised by Turkish Air during transit but had to buy a visa. The Turks were courteous. The food is plentiful on Turkish Air but traditional basic cuisine. The tour was on time with guidance provided and a meal at a local restaurant. It was interesting and memorable.
Verified travelerFlew with Turkish AirlinesIST-KULAug 2024
Make sure you understand the WiFi process when flying with Turkish airlines and note that the Istanbul airport doesn’t post flight gates until 2hrs before the flight departs.

Verified travelerFlew with Singapore AirlinesMXP-SINJan 2024
The SG airport (Changi) is, on its own, a destination. Plan a decent layover time if you've never been there before.

  • How far in advance should I book a flight from Europe to Southeast Asia?

    To get a below-average price on the flight from Europe to Southeast Asia, you should book around 4 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 19 weeks before departure.

  • How long is the flight to Southeast Asia?

    An average direct flight from Europe to Southeast Asia takes 16h 11m, covering a distance of 16224 km. The shortest route is Istanbul Airport (IST) to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port (KUL) with an average flight time of 10h 10m.
